About the artist

Wang Lei was born in 1980 in Henan, China, and is one of the most prominent contemporary artists in China. Wang Lei has an eye for intimate details and subtleties. He brings an art piece to life by absorbing all historical and social factors as a subtle culture within layers of time. We see this not only in the context of his artwork but also in the process of designing and creating. Wang Lei’s artworks succeed in its contemporary agenda to communicate with a vast range of audiences from different backgrounds.
He uses paper and twists it into long, delicate threads which are then woven into reproductions of Chinese robes. The manipulation of this tough-textured paper into the composition of such an exquisite garment highlights the problems surrounding the relationship between viewer perceptions and reality. Wang Lei also draws attention to the often-disputed interconnectedness of traditional and contemporary art, focusing on the reverence for history and tradition as a central obstacle which hinders the acceptance of contemporary art in China.
